go
Topic

go

Go is a programming language built to resemble a simplified version of the C programming language. It compiles at the machine level. Go was created at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.

Repositories (1341)

golang-set
golang-set deckarep Go

A simple, battle-tested and generic set type for the Go language. Trusted by GoogleCloudPlatform, Docker, 1Password, Ethereum and Hashicorp.

4.7k
progressbar
progressbar schollz Go

A really basic thread-safe progress bar for Golang applications

4.7k
pouch
pouch AliyunContainerService Go

An Efficient Enterprise-class Container Engine

4.7k
mage
mage magefile Go

a Make/rake-like dev tool using Go

4.6k
json-to-go
json-to-go mholt JavaScript

Translates JSON into a Go type in your browser instantly (original)

4.6k
docker-gen
docker-gen nginx-proxy Go

Generate files from docker container meta-data

4.6k
go-cmp
go-cmp google Go

Package for comparing Go values in tests

4.6k
geekai
geekai yangjian102621 Vue

AI 助手全套开源解决方案,自带运营管理后台,开箱即用。集成了 ChatGPT, Azure, ChatGLM,讯飞星火,文心一言等多个平台的大语言模型。支持 MJ AI 绘画,Stable...

4.6k
golang-samples
golang-samples GoogleCloudPlatform Go

Sample apps and code written for Google Cloud in the Go programming language.

4.6k
kaitai_struct
kaitai_struct kaitai-io Shell

Kaitai Struct: declarative language to generate binary data parsers in C++ / C# / Go / Java / JavaScript / Lua / Nim / Perl / PHP / Python / Ruby / Ru...

4.6k
jupiter
jupiter douyu Go

Jupiter: Governance-oriented Microservice Framework.

4.6k
prest
prest prest Go

PostgreSQL ➕ REST, low-code, simplify and accelerate development, ⚡ instant, realtime, high-performance on any Postgres application, existing or new

4.5k
pixel
pixel faiface Go

A hand-crafted 2D game library in Go

4.5k
concurrent-map
concurrent-map orcaman Go

a thread-safe concurrent map for go

4.5k
dockertest
dockertest ory Go

Write better integration tests! Dockertest helps you boot up ephermal docker images for your Go tests with minimal work.

4.5k
goravel
goravel goravel Go

The full-featured Golang Development Framework skeleton

4.5k
ergo
ergo ergo-services Go

An actor-based Framework with network transparency for creating event-driven architecture in Golang. Inspired by Erlang. Zero dependencies.

4.5k
paopao-ce
paopao-ce rocboss Go

A scalable social community platform powered by Gin backend and modern TypeScript/Vue frontend architecture

4.5k
go-recipes
go-recipes nikolaydubina Go

🦩 Tools for Go projects

4.5k
examples
examples gin-gonic Go

A repository to host examples and tutorials for Gin.

4.5k
dig
dig uber-go Go

A reflection based dependency injection toolkit for Go.

4.5k
realize
realize oxequa Go

Realize is the #1 Golang Task Runner which enhance your workflow by automating the most common tasks and using the best performing Golang live reloadi...

4.4k
google-cloud-go
google-cloud-go googleapis Go

Google Cloud Client Libraries for Go.

4.4k
kaiju
kaiju KaijuEngine Go

General purpose 3D and 2D game engine using Go (golang) and Vulkan with built in editor

4.4k
google-api-go-client
google-api-go-client googleapis Go

Auto-generated Google APIs for Go.

4.4k
archiver
archiver mholt Go

DEPRECATED. Please use mholt/archives instead.

4.4k
cointop
cointop cointop-sh Go

A fast and lightweight interactive terminal based UI application for tracking cryptocurrencies 🚀 by @miguelmota

4.4k
spank
spank taigrr Go

Slap your MacBook, it yells back. Uses Apple Silicon accelerometer via IOKit HID.

4.4k
go-sdk
go-sdk modelcontextprotocol Go

The official Go SDK for Model Context Protocol servers and clients. Maintained in collaboration with Google.

4.4k
cerbos
cerbos cerbos Go

Cerbos is the open core, language-agnostic, scalable authorization solution that makes user permissions and authorization simple to implement and mana...

4.4k
under-the-hood
under-the-hood golang-design Go

📚 Go: Under The Hood | Go 语言原本 | https://golang.design/under-the-hood

4.3k
echoip
echoip mpolden Go

A simple IP address lookup service.

4.3k
console
console redpanda-data TypeScript

Redpanda Console is a developer-friendly UI for managing your Kafka/Redpanda workloads. Console gives you a simple, interactive approach for gaining v...

4.3k
mgmt
mgmt purpleidea Go

Next generation distributed, event-driven, parallel config management!

4.2k
bild
bild anthonynsimon Go

Image processing algorithms in pure Go

4.2k
iam
iam marmotedu Go

企业级的 Go 语言实战项目:认证和授权系统(带配套课程)

4.2k
go-fastdfs
go-fastdfs sjqzhang Go

go-fastdfs 是一个简单的分布式文件系统(私有云存储),具有无中心、高性能,高可靠,免维护等优点,支持断点续传,分块上传,小文件合并,自动同步,自动修复。G...

4.1k
grv
grv rgburke Go

GRV is a terminal interface for viewing git repositories

4.1k
minify
minify tdewolff Go

Go minifiers for web formats

4.1k
ozzo-validation
ozzo-validation go-ozzo Go

An idiomatic Go (golang) validation package. Supports configurable and extensible validation rules (validators) using normal language constructs inste...

4.1k
App-Store-Connect-CLI
App-Store-Connect-CLI rorkai Go

Fast, scriptable CLI for the App Store Connect API. Automate TestFlight, builds, submissions, signing, analytics, screenshots, subscriptions, and more...

4.1k
melody
melody olahol Go

:notes: Minimalist websocket framework for Go

4.1k
dubbo-admin
dubbo-admin apache Go

The ops and reference implementation for Apache Dubbo.

4.1k
golang-notes
golang-notes cch123 HTML

Go source code analysis(zh-cn)

4k
tunny
tunny Jeffail Go

A goroutine pool for Go

4k
wal-g
wal-g wal-g Go

Archival and Restoration for databases in the Cloud

4k
s5cmd
s5cmd peak Go

Parallel S3 and local filesystem execution tool.

4k
TorBot
TorBot DedSecInside Python

Dark Web OSINT Tool

4k
mtail
mtail google Go

extract internal monitoring data from application logs for collection in a timeseries database

4k
emitter
emitter emitter-io Go

High performance, distributed and low latency publish-subscribe platform.

4k